AECOM - Riyadh, Saudi Arabia 24 days ago
AECOM - Riyadh, Saudi Arabia 24 days ago
Alstom - Riyadh, Saudi Arabia 24 days ago
AECOM - Riyadh, Saudi Arabia 24 days ago
SITA - Riyadh, Saudi Arabia 24 days ago
Eyego - Riyadh, Saudi Arabia 25 days ago

Yalla - Riyadh, Saudi Arabia 27 days ago
- Showing 61 - 80 of 124
Browse New Jobs in Saudi Arabia